To convert SDV files to MP4, you first need to identify which type of SDV file you have. This extension is primarily used for Pinnacle Studio project files or specialized video formats from older Samsung digital cameras. 1. Identify Your SDV File Type

Samsung Camera Format: Some older Samsung camcorders saved video data in a format labeled .sdv. These are often "hidden" MPEG-2 or AVI files.

Pinnacle Studio Project: If the file is small (under 1MB), it is likely a Studio DV project file which only contains editing instructions, not actual video. You must open this in Pinnacle Studio and "Export" or "Render" it to MP4.

Other Formats: It could also be a StarOffice Gallery View file or a Smart Diary Suite voice file, which cannot be converted to video. 2. Best Free Software Converters

If your SDV file contains actual video data, use these tools to convert it to MP4: VLC Media Player (Universal & Free): Open VLC Media Player. Go to Media > Convert / Save. Add your .sdv file. Choose the Video - H.264 + MP3 (MP4) profile. Select a destination and click Start. HandBrake (Best for High Quality): Download HandBrake. Drag your file into the window. Select the MP4 container and a preset like "Fast 1080p30". Click Start Encode. CloudConvert (Best for Online): Visit CloudConvert. Upload your file and set the output to MP4.

Note: This is best for small files under 1GB due to upload times. 3. Troubleshooting "Unconvertible" Files

Rename the Extension: Sometimes an SDV file is just an AVI file with a different name. Try copying the file and changing the extension from .sdv to .avi or .mpg to see if it plays in standard players.

Check File Size: If your SDV file is only a few kilobytes, it contains no video. You need to find the original raw footage files (likely .avi or .mts) that were used in the project.

The "Renaming" Trick: For Samsung cameras, if the file won't open, renaming it to .mp4 directly sometimes works if the underlying codec is already H.264. Part 7: Frequently Asked Questions

Q: Is converting SDV to MP4 legal? A: Yes, if you own the video content (e.g., home videos). If the SDV file contains copyrighted TV broadcasts, converting for personal archival use is generally considered fair use, but redistribution is illegal.

Q: Will I lose quality when converting from SDV to MP4? A: If you use a proper converter and a high bitrate, the quality loss will be imperceptible to the human eye. However, because MP4 uses compression, file size may decrease (which is usually a good thing).

Q: Can VLC Media Player convert SDV to MP4? A: VLC can play some SDV files, but its conversion feature is hit-or-miss. Go to Media > Convert/Save, add the SDV file, and select "Video - H.264 + MP3 (MP4)." It works roughly 60% of the time.

Q: My SDV file is protected (DRM). Can I convert it? A: Most SDV files are not truly DRM-protected; they are just obfuscated. However, if the file requires a license key to play, no standard converter will work. Removing DRM without permission is illegal in most jurisdictions.

Part 6: Step-by-Step Workflow for Archiving SDV Family Videos

If you have a hard drive full of old SDV recordings, follow this professional archiving workflow:

  1. Consolidate: Copy all .sdv files from your old DVD recorder or HDD to a single folder on your computer.
  2. Analyze: Open one file in FFmpeg to check the codec (ffmpeg -i example.sdv). Look for "MPEG-2 Video."
  3. Choose your converter: Select a desktop tool like UniConverter or Movavi.
  4. Configure output: Set output to MP4 (H.264 + AAC). Set frame rate to "Same as source." Set quality to "High" or 100%.
  5. Batch convert: Run the entire folder overnight.
  6. Verify: Play the new MP4 files in VLC to ensure audio/video sync.
  7. Backup: Save the MP4 files to cloud storage (Google Drive, iCloud) and an external SSD.
